Jump to content
Fórum Script Brasil
  • 0
Sign in to follow this  
fertel

Aspmail - 12 Horas Depois? Bincadeira Hein?

Question

Olá

Abaixo a definição de uma variável que seria o corpo da mensagem:

MENSAGEM_VENDA = "<HTML><HEAD><title>titulo #" & ID & " - " & Session("TITULO") & "</title></HEAD>" _
& "<BODY><table width=500 border=0 cellspacing=0 cellpadding=0>" _
& "<tr><td width=72 valign=top><img src=logo.gif width=72 height=60></td><td valign=middle bgcolor=#003366>" _
& "<div align=center><font color=#FFFFFF size=3 face=Arial, Helvetica, sans-serif><br>"

Sempre utilizei desta forma e sempre funcionou.

Agora precisei mudar de servidor e na Locaweb não funciona, dá uma mensagem de erro:

Microsoft VBScript compilation error "800a0401"

Expected end of statement

/teste.asp, line 8

Set Mailer = Server.CreateObject("SMTPsvg.Mailer")

Então? Alguém sabe o por quê? Os funcionários de lá não explicaram a causa. Será que realmente não poderei utilizar desta forma que escrevo?

Share this post


Link to post
Share on other sites

6 answers to this question

Recommended Posts

  • 0

o erro não esta no componente e sim que esta faltando ou sobrando um end if ai. poste todo codigo...

Share this post


Link to post
Share on other sites
  • 0

Não tem End If no código não amigo...

É só isso aí que você está vendo + o necessário para envio pelo componente.

Concordo que a Locaweb tá estranha. Isso é problema nos servidores. Até as mensagens do Help Desk chegam umas 3 horas depois.

Na realidade eles trabalham com Cdonts, ASPmail e ASPEmail.

Mas curiosamente testei o envio de umas 6 mensagens com cada componente e só chegou uma pelo Cdonts. Um absurdo... Já estou preocupado com esta situação.

Share this post


Link to post
Share on other sites
  • 0

O que eu quiz dizer e o seguinte, esta mensagem não e erro de componente e sim erro de compilaçao asp, então deve ter algo no codigo que não esta suprindo as espectativas de compilacao do servidor, e isso fica mais facil de se ver com o codigo inteiro, nesta parte que você postou não vi nada de errado

...

Share this post


Link to post
Share on other sites
  • 0

O que eu posso te dizer é o seguinte.

Primeiro, acesse a pagina:

http://www.locaweb.com.br/ajuda/componentes_asp/

Depois, clique no componente que você esta utilizando.

Copie o codigo que eles dão de exemplo.

Rode e veja se funciona.

Se não funcionar nem o codigo deles, o problema é com eles mesmo.

Agora, se o codigo deles funcionar, aí é seu codigo.

então, pegue o codigo deles, e modifique para o seu.

Captou?

Share this post


Link to post
Share on other sites
  • 0

Sim, claro... mas então, isso é o que foi feito...

Além disso trabalho com este tipo de envio há muito tempo. Tudo bem, poderia ser um erro meu, mas não foi este caso. Com relação ao dito sobre erro de compilação, você enstá certo, tb pensei isso, mas aí que está, não havia If/End If naquele código. E ainda assim gerava o erro. Mas resolvi "aquele" mudando um pouco a estrutura que costumo escrever a mensagem que só dá erro lá na Locaweb.

Tentei durante a madrugada inteira resolver o problema, mas acho que os funcionários que ficam na empresa durante a madrugada só sabem "encher linguiça"...

Bom, agora de manhã às 5:30h chegaram finalmente todos os e-mails enviados. 12 horas depois!!!

Um absurdo!!! Já avisei a eles de uma resolução ou vou abandonar a empresa... Se os sevidores não estão dando suporte a demanda, compra-se mais equipamento, banda, etc... Porque não adianta ficar se gabando de ter 100 mil clientes na primeira página deles se os servidores não dão suporte. Como pode os e-mails ficarem numa fila por 12 horas? 12 horas parece pouco? Mas não é não, é uma eternidade para equipamentos que trabalham em nano-segundos...

Além deste problema do e-mail, algumas vezes notei uma lentidão enorme no processo de acesso ao site, e tudo que eles disseram era que seria um problema de cookies ou no meu computador. Engraçado que o problema era só nos sites que tinha hospedados com eles... Os outros estavam normais. Para nós que trabalhamos com isso, até dói no ouvido ouvir certos absurdos de funcionários que nem sabem o que estão falando, ou a empresa não admite problemas operacionais/estruturais.

De qualquer forma só estou aqui desabafando, porque evidente que eles vão continuar sendo a empresa Nº1 do mercado e eu apenas um merdinha de um cliente reclamando sem razão...rs

Fazer o quê? Faz parte da nossa profissão engolir estes "sapos"... dry.gif

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  



  • Forum Statistics

    • Total Topics
      148116
    • Total Posts
      643397
×
×
  • Create New...